Historical and Botanical Overview Origins and Historical Uses Aloe has a rich history spanning thousands of years, with records of its use dating back to ancient civilizations such as the Egyptians, Greeks, and Romans. Known as the "plant of immortality" by the Egyptians, aloe was used for its healing properties and even in the embalming process.
